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2
The NM_013243.4(SCG3):c.450C>A(p.Asp150Glu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000781 in 1,613,704 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SCG3 (HGNC:13707): (secretogranin III) The protein encoded by this gene is a member of the chromogranin/secretogranin family of neuroendocrine secretory proteins. Granins may serve as precursors for biologically active peptides. Some granins have been shown to function as helper proteins in sorting and proteolytic processing of prohormones; however, the function of this protein is unknown. Two trans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Sep 2009]

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Sep 27, 2024 | The c.450C>A (p.D150E) alteration is located in exon 5 (coding exon 5) of the SCG3 gene. This alteration results from a C to A substitution at nucleotide position 450, causing the aspartic acid (D) at amino acid position 150 to be replaced by a glutamic acid (E).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
